Chelsea have reportedly blacklisted Barcelona from signing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ang, who would “love” to return, due to the Catalan club’s approaches for the striker.
Chelsea have reportedly put a spanner in the works for Barcelona’s potential move for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ang.
The Gabonese striker, who enjoyed a successful spell at Barcelona earlier in his career, is said to be keen on a return to the Catalan giants. However, according to Spanish outlet AS, Chelsea has blacklisted Barcelona from signing the veteran striker, following the Blaugrana’s alleged approaches for the player.
Aubameyang has had a disastrous season at Stamford Bridge, managing just 12 Premier League appearances, mostly from the bench, and not making it to the Champions League knockout rounds squad.
Despite his struggles, the striker’s desire to return to Barcelona seems undiminished. Chelsea’s decision to refuse any potential move for the player appears to be an attempt to rectify their mistake of bringing him in for a hefty fee in the first place.
